Section Text

Highlight any text to annotate
In addition to funds otherwise authorized to be appropriated to the Fund to carry out this title,11 See References in Text note below. there are authorized to be appropriated to the Administrator to carry out this chapter—(1) $15,000,000 for fiscal year 2000; (2) $15,000,000 for fiscal year 2001; (3) $15,000,000 for fiscal year 2002; and (4) $15,000,000 for fiscal year 2003. (Pub. L. 103–325, title I, § 180, as added Pub. L. 106–102, title VII, § 725, Nov. 12, 1999, 113 Stat. 1474.) Editorial Notes References in TextThis title, referred to in text, is title I of Pub. L. 103–325, Sept. 23, 1994, 108 Stat. 2163. Subtitle A (§§ 101–121) of title I, known as the Community Development Banking and Financial Institutions Act of 1994, is classified principally to subchapter I (§ 4701 et seq.) of chapter 47 of Title 12, Banks and Banking. Subtitle B (§§ 151–158) of title I, known as the Home Ownership and Equity Protection Act of 1994, enacted sections 1639 and 1648 of this title, amended sections 1602, 1604, 1610, 1640, 1641, and 1647 of this title, and enacted provisions set out as notes under sections 1601 and 1602 of this title. Subtitle C (§§ 171–181) of title I, known as the Program for Investment in Microentrepreneurs Act of 1999 or PRIME Act, is classified generally to this chapter. For complete classification of title I of Pub. L. 103–325 to the Code, see Tables.
